Transaction 53677bb7c586dfa19274658bfb2d133181822997a783c50125f35fc3d0e97f7e
1 Input
1 Output
-
53677bb7c586dfa19274658bfb2d133181822997a783c50125f35fc3d0e97f7e:0
- value
- 37097740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71bea4e8c3f6209ce149eb14fd6d6597bdfefbb7 OP_EQUAL
- address
- 3C4SfQkCk5nMq3MQBWxkQGPeAPfuLicwTV